The Rise of Cultural Narratives in Mobile Gaming
Mobile gaming, with its accessibility and low entry barriers, has become a significant conduit for cultural dissemination. Titles like Egypt Fortune Rise exemplify this shift, integrating historical themes into engaging gameplay mechanics. According to industry data, the global mobile gaming market is projected to reach $120 billion in revenue by 2024, underscoring the importance of culturally rich titles to capture diverse demographics.
Historical and archaeological themes resonate deeply with players, especially when combined with engaging storytelling and interactive elements. Mobile games that incorporate authentic Egyptian motifs—such as hieroglyphs, pharaohs, and pyramids—not only entertain but also serve an educational role, stimulating curiosity about ancient civilizations.

The Future of Cultural Themes in Mobile Gaming
Looking ahead, the integration of augmented reality (AR) and artificial intelligence (AI) promises to deepen the immersion of Egyptian-themed games, making players feel as if they are explorers within ancient temples or deciphering hieroglyphs alongside historians. Such innovations will require collaboration between cultural scholars, game developers, and technologists to preserve authenticity while enhancing interactivity.
